Epicurious member and Maine resident Jesse Wakeman first made this ultimate breakfast burrito when he was in fifth grade. It’s fast (under 20 minutes), tasty, and simple to make. To warm the tortillas, arrange them in a single layer on a baking sheet and bake in a 350°F oven until just heated through, about 30 seconds. Alternatively, wrap the tortillas loosely in a damp towel and place in the microwave on high for about 20 seconds.
